Transaction 54265d21a1beec9944576daaa827b15bd2ee0d6ca8c0716337b75581d150eeb4

1 Input
2 Outputs
  • 54265d21a1beec9944576daaa827b15bd2ee0d6ca8c0716337b75581d150eeb4:0
  • value  920000
    address  3PQHFWLY8Rv5eug9KMvep7tvWL2Uf1A2Fo
  • 54265d21a1beec9944576daaa827b15bd2ee0d6ca8c0716337b75581d150eeb4:1
  • value  20117866
    address  127CfkzSNHUL9DHBHqTdmrTuLaEmoQeEU8